Work will begin on, or shortly after Monday 7 September 2015 to overlay the existing footway both sides for the whole length of Rectory Lane. The work is expected to take approximately 8 weeks to complete.
There will be a road closure on Rectory Lane at the Junction with B1332/210 for 5 days. Temporary lights will be used for further 7 weeks to control traffic during lane closures.
A local signed diversion route will be put in place during the closure and vehicular access to properties will be maintained during the works and disruption will be kept to a minimum. Emergency services and bus operators will be informed of the closure. The County Council apologises for any inconvenience this may cause.
The work which will cost £32,100 will be carried out by Norfolk County Council’s Community and Environmental Services Department and their contractors.
